I've got a problem I can't figure out. I hope this thread is the correct place for my question.

I download some audio only things off a few radio internet shows. I usually just click "save audio" and the program is saved to listen to later.There is no download button shown to save the audio file. I use this for a number of non-music related things I'm interested in. I guess these are referred to as embedded audio files? One station has changed something about the player they provide and now I don't have the option to "save audio". In the long run this probably doesn't matter but my untechnical self would still like to figure a way around this.

Is there any program I can get just to capture a audio file? This should capture the whole file without letting the program run as I record it. This is not Youtube related so there is no video, just fairly small mp3 files. Thanks for any suggestions.

Probably youtube-dl would work. It's a command line program. Install it and then go to the folder where it is installed, hold down SHIFT and click the right mouse button and choose "open command window here"

The two commands you need are:

youtube-dl -F INSERT URL OF PAGE (eg: https://cavernsessions.com/Beatles/October_1961)

that will give you a list of streams embedded in the page, then run

youtube-dl -f INSERT STREAM CODE FOR MP3 (eg: mp3-4534) INSERT PAGE URL

and that's it.

Or you can use it for videos.
